I adore this game, believe it's the best Alien game to date, especially modded, but besides Stompy having their footsteps be too loud, I also find another thing unfortunate. I love the fear and mood it creates, but neither in the movies, nor realistically would anyone be able to hide from the Aliens. You can't do that from most predators cause of their sense of smell, so I'm certain you wouldn't be able to from an Alien, not for long, that's why you have to be on the move constantly. I always preferred the interpretation "you can run, but you can't hide".

I had so many doubts in general but Amanda Ripley was a particular complaint at the time the game was announced, largely due to the negative impact left by the atrocity that was Aliens: Colonial Marines.

After actually playing the game though Amanda Ripley is a part of the reason why the game was as good as it was, her presence really does make sense and adds an emotional impact that would of been unachievable otherwise.

I was skeptical about Amanda before the game came out, but it just wouldn't have the same impact when she finds that flight recorder if it wasn't her. It works. It's only natural that Amanda might go looking for her mother, ends up in the same area of space where she went missing and finds something related. It wasn't a stretch in the slightest and it gave the story some real emotional depth.
